A luxury fortress on wheels

The Aurus Senat is a full-size luxury limousine developed by Russian automaker Aurus Motors. It emerged from Russia's Kortezh project, which was created to develop high-end vehicles for government use.

Introduced in 2018, the Senat draws design inspiration from the Soviet-era ZIS-110 limousine. A civilian version is also produced, with annual output limited to 120 units. It is priced at around 18 million rubles, or approximately Rs 2.5 crore.

Putin's version, however, is significantly more specialised, combining a luxury limousine experience with heavy armour and protection designed for presidential travel.

Powerful engine, imposing dimensions

The Senat is powered by a 4.4-litre twin-turbocharged V8 engine working with a hybrid system. It produces approximately 598 horsepower and 880 Nm of torque and is paired with a nine-speed automatic transmission.

The limousine measures 5,630 mm in length, 2,000 mm in width and 1,700 mm in height. Its 3,300 mm wheelbase adds to its imposing road presence. The car can reach a top speed of around 160 kmph and accelerate from 0 to 100 kmph in approximately nine seconds.

Presidential luxury inside

The cabin is designed around comfort as much as security. High-end leather, wood trim and advanced infotainment systems give the Senat the feel of a premium executive limousine.

The vehicle is also engineered to operate in extreme climates, while its security systems include advanced braking, electronic traction control, active cruise control and lane departure warning.

With its combination of presidential-grade protection, spacious proportions and lavish interiors, the Aurus Senat serves as both a secure transport vehicle and a showcase of Russian automotive luxury.
